Is he breathing?
That's the question Tony and I have been asking ourselves every night since Oliver's surgery. It has been nearly one month since Oliver had his tonsils and adenoids removed and *wow* -- it has changed his nighttime breathing dramatically! He went from a snoring machine / heavy breather to being so still and quiet we regularly check to be sure he is, in fact, still breathing.

Pretty amazing. Night time breathing aside, he seems to be fully recovered. I'm sure there is still a little healing going on back there, but he isn't in pain and he's enjoying all the crunchy and hard foods he couldn't have during his recovery. 

His recovery was full of ups and downs -- as expected. There was the "wonderful" 2:30 am wake up morning that I won't forget anytime soon, lots of refusals to eat or drink (a common issue when he doesn't feel well), and approximately 20 viewings of the Angry Birds mini episodes blu-ray.
